The Painted Screen

Color in cinema communicates on levels audiences rarely notice:

  • Early Technicolor established color as expressive rather than merely realistic
  • Directors use palette as narrative shorthand for mood, era, and psychology
  • Warm and cool tones split a story into worlds you feel before you think
  • Color grading is now one of the most powerful yet invisible storytelling tools

The next time a film makes you feel something you cannot quite name, watch the colors. The screen has been speaking to your subconscious the whole time.
